summaryrefslogtreecommitdiff
path: root/devel/qtscriptgenerator
diff options
context:
space:
mode:
authormarkd <markd>2012-03-10 20:42:31 +0000
committermarkd <markd>2012-03-10 20:42:31 +0000
commit178802c5671bf5dd310cb0c3b687faaad95a5677 (patch)
tree1d6c63d974c1600f6967d98ea9920b3fac252474 /devel/qtscriptgenerator
parent191eb60872bea87c7a9427cd9ff16298d8be9806 (diff)
downloadpkgsrc-178802c5671bf5dd310cb0c3b687faaad95a5677.tar.gz
Fix build with qt4.8, from fedora by way of gentoo
Diffstat (limited to 'devel/qtscriptgenerator')
-rw-r--r--devel/qtscriptgenerator/Makefile4
-rw-r--r--devel/qtscriptgenerator/PLIST3
-rw-r--r--devel/qtscriptgenerator/distinfo4
-rw-r--r--devel/qtscriptgenerator/patches/patch-generator_typesystem_gui-common.xml14
-rw-r--r--devel/qtscriptgenerator/patches/patch-generator_typesystem_gui.xml14
5 files changed, 34 insertions, 5 deletions
diff --git a/devel/qtscriptgenerator/Makefile b/devel/qtscriptgenerator/Makefile
index c679f8743e0..ffc105a8d1d 100644
--- a/devel/qtscriptgenerator/Makefile
+++ b/devel/qtscriptgenerator/Makefile
@@ -1,9 +1,9 @@
-# $NetBSD: Makefile,v 1.12 2012/03/03 00:12:26 wiz Exp $
+# $NetBSD: Makefile,v 1.13 2012/03/10 20:42:31 markd Exp $
#
DISTNAME= qtscriptgenerator-src-0.1.0
PKGNAME= ${DISTNAME:S/-src//}
-PKGREVISION= 14
+PKGREVISION= 15
CATEGORIES= devel
MASTER_SITES= http://qtscriptgenerator.googlecode.com/files/
diff --git a/devel/qtscriptgenerator/PLIST b/devel/qtscriptgenerator/PLIST
index cf7848b216f..4ac34391867 100644
--- a/devel/qtscriptgenerator/PLIST
+++ b/devel/qtscriptgenerator/PLIST
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.1.1.1 2010/02/15 15:57:49 wiz Exp $
+@comment $NetBSD: PLIST,v 1.2 2012/03/10 20:42:31 markd Exp $
qt4/bin/generator
qt4/plugins/script/libqtscript_core.la
qt4/plugins/script/libqtscript_gui.la
@@ -156,7 +156,6 @@ share/doc/qtscriptgenerator/qfile.html
share/doc/qtscriptgenerator/qfiledialog.html
share/doc/qtscriptgenerator/qfileiconprovider.html
share/doc/qtscriptgenerator/qfileinfo.html
-share/doc/qtscriptgenerator/qfileopenevent.html
share/doc/qtscriptgenerator/qfilesystemwatcher.html
share/doc/qtscriptgenerator/qfocusevent.html
share/doc/qtscriptgenerator/qfocusframe.html
diff --git a/devel/qtscriptgenerator/distinfo b/devel/qtscriptgenerator/distinfo
index a13be3f2e9d..79bc61468f3 100644
--- a/devel/qtscriptgenerator/distinfo
+++ b/devel/qtscriptgenerator/distinfo
@@ -1,7 +1,9 @@
-$NetBSD: distinfo,v 1.2 2011/02/17 09:51:01 markd Exp $
+$NetBSD: distinfo,v 1.3 2012/03/10 20:42:31 markd Exp $
SHA1 (qtscriptgenerator-src-0.1.0.tar.gz) = eeae733106369e289f257b754822bc372fd6ba75
RMD160 (qtscriptgenerator-src-0.1.0.tar.gz) = a02ce6fea2fbc3d3a6ae9e51c6b563ef4bcd51f3
Size (qtscriptgenerator-src-0.1.0.tar.gz) = 374223 bytes
SHA1 (patch-aa) = 6c44dc4f44345bf6349b0d678901f174c262f6a9
SHA1 (patch-generator_parser_rpp_pp.h) = deb9a7608ad2feea577e8445f02f41f5fda8d7a7
+SHA1 (patch-generator_typesystem_gui-common.xml) = ff3770853b75a9dbd80516e1ed10988c7cd954ec
+SHA1 (patch-generator_typesystem_gui.xml) = a72c32924b23655c7b9fcd5d9ccef180cee1b756
diff --git a/devel/qtscriptgenerator/patches/patch-generator_typesystem_gui-common.xml b/devel/qtscriptgenerator/patches/patch-generator_typesystem_gui-common.xml
new file mode 100644
index 00000000000..d14dba2fe9f
--- /dev/null
+++ b/devel/qtscriptgenerator/patches/patch-generator_typesystem_gui-common.xml
@@ -0,0 +1,14 @@
+$NetBSD: patch-generator_typesystem_gui-common.xml,v 1.1 2012/03/10 20:42:31 markd Exp $
+
+Fix build with qt4.8, from fedora by way of gentoo
+
+--- generator/typesystem_gui-common.xml.orig 2012-02-15 22:42:52.385763112 +0000
++++ generator/typesystem_gui-common.xml
+@@ -2233,7 +2233,6 @@
+
+
+ </object-type>
+- <object-type name="QFileOpenEvent" polymorphic-id-expression="%1-&gt;type() == QEvent::FileOpen"/>
+ <object-type name="QFocusEvent" polymorphic-id-expression="%1-&gt;type() == QEvent::FocusIn || %1-&gt;type() == QEvent::FocusOut">
+ <modify-function signature="reason()const">
+ <remove/>
diff --git a/devel/qtscriptgenerator/patches/patch-generator_typesystem_gui.xml b/devel/qtscriptgenerator/patches/patch-generator_typesystem_gui.xml
new file mode 100644
index 00000000000..d4b5ad31d89
--- /dev/null
+++ b/devel/qtscriptgenerator/patches/patch-generator_typesystem_gui.xml
@@ -0,0 +1,14 @@
+$NetBSD: patch-generator_typesystem_gui.xml,v 1.1 2012/03/10 20:42:31 markd Exp $
+
+Fix build with qt4.8, from fedora by way of gentoo
+
+--- generator/typesystem_gui.xml.orig 2012-02-15 22:44:29.367566923 +0000
++++ generator/typesystem_gui.xml
+@@ -2555,7 +2555,6 @@
+
+
+ </object-type>
+- <object-type name="QFileOpenEvent" polymorphic-id-expression="%1-&gt;type() == QEvent::FileOpen"/>
+ <object-type name="QFocusEvent" polymorphic-id-expression="%1-&gt;type() == QEvent::FocusIn || %1-&gt;type() == QEvent::FocusOut">
+ <modify-function signature="reason()const">
+ <remove/>